Acer truncation Bunge is a species of the Acer family plants. It has been found that the plant is a new-type with great and integrative value owing to the oil, protein, tannin and adversity-resistant to environment. By accordance with the demands of scientific base and technical support in exploitation of the new resource, the biological characteristics, the choosing guideline for excellent individuals and the methodology of breeding seedlings had been studied systematically, and chemical composition of seed, accumulative dry matter changes, the functions of the protein in processing were determined in the paper. It is the first time that the protein was tested and used in food processing. The feasibility for leaves of the tree to be made for teas was studied and optimized processing techniques were searched for. The purpose of the study was to fill the blanks in researching fields on the tree in order to establish a base for the resource utilization. The main points were as folio wings:The biological characteristics, including morphological features of organs, phenological features, growth processes, blooming and seeding rules and life cycle were observed so as to build the guideline for choosing excellent individuals and the methodology for breeding seedlings.Taking the economical characters of seed as the leading choosing standards and others as assistant ones, ten superior individuals had been selected after a three-step selection. At the same time, a choosing guideline system for superior individual selection of the tree was put forward.A systematic study on breeding methodology was conducted with technologies of grafting, cuttage, tissue culture, seed propagation and seedlings cultivation. The highest survival rate of 87.5% was achieved when the grafting method was adopted with yearling as rootstock, with 4-5cm long grafting budwoods, with the embed skill and under the clear days. It was an effective way to make the excellent individuals propagated. But cuttage was not suitable for the reproduction of the plant. The experiments on tissue culture showed that explants grew better in the MS medium with the TDZ of 0.01-0.05 μm,and the rooting rate from young stems was the highest, 90.91%, when 1/2 MS medium with 0.1μm IBA was used under the photoperiod of 16h each day. The surviving rate of the young seedlings reached 95% after being hardened and transplanted to pots. The most suitable sowing time was the second and last ten-daysof March, with the seeds dipped in water.A bigger growth speed of seedlings occurred when seedling plots covered with a plasticfilm after being planted. There was a quicker growth in height from June to August, and aquicker increase in width of stems from first ten days of June to middle of Sep. Therefore,the period was the key time in the water-fertilizer management of the seedling plots. It isan effective approach to obtain healthy seedlings with stubbed seedlings owing to theirsignificant growth and straight stock.The chemical component of seeds and the accumulative characters of oil and dry matterin the development of seeds were determined in the study. There was an oil content of47.88% and a protein content of 27.15% in the seed kernel. The oil accumulation startedat the bottom of July, and reached the biggest amount while the period from the end ofAug. to the end of Sep. The seeds could be harvested at the end of Oct. when there wasthe highest oil content in seeds in Yang Ling region.The feature of solubility, foaming and emulsification of the protein were tested anddetermined. The isoelectric point of the protein was pH4.38. According to thedetermination, the tendency and direction of the protein utilization in food processingwere put forwardA primary system of scientific foundation and relevant technologies had been establishedin the paper so that to promote the utilization of the new-type resource.
